THE CAPLIN HOUSE BY FREDERICK FISHER | 1979 VENICE ARCHITECTURAL RESIDENCE
Few homes in Venice have a story as specific as The Caplin House by Frederick Fisher. Designed in 1979 as Fisher’s first independent residential project, the house captures an important moment in the evolution of Southern California architecture and the experimental design culture that came to define Venice.Located at 229 San Juan Avenue, The Caplin House is both an early work by architect Frederick Fisher and a highly individual expression of late 1970s Los Angeles residential architecture. More than four decades after its completion, the residence remains remarkably original, revealing the ideas about light, movement and spatial experience that would become central to Fisher’s architectural career.
Completed in 1979, The Caplin House represents Frederick Fisher’s first independent residential project, giving the residence particular significance within the architect’s body of work. Designed at a moment when Venice was becoming a laboratory for a new generation of Southern California architects, the house reflects the freedom and experimentation of its setting.Rather than following a conventional domestic plan, Fisher organized the residence around a dramatic central volume that brings daylight deep into the interior and establishes the spatial rhythm of the home. Skylights, exposed structure, bridges, balconies and shifting ceiling heights create an architecture that feels open yet continually changing.Moving through the house reveals a sequence of perspectives rather than a collection of separate rooms. Each level offers a new relationship to the central space, reinforcing the sense that the entire residence was conceived as one interconnected architectural composition.
